Madden wants to be Carlisle hit

Image: Madden: Hopes to achieve with Cumbrians

Carlisle striker Paddy Madden admits he still hopes he can prove himself to be a regular goalscorer at the club.

Madden, who is currently on loan with fellow League One side Yeovil, netted twice for the Glovers on Saturday - the same tally he managed in 21 appearances in Cumbria. But the 22-year-old insists his long-term ambition remains to become a success with his parent club. "I have enjoyed Carlisle, there are great people there and, hopefully, in the future I can get that run of games for them that I have wanted," he told the News & Star. "I will have to prove myself [at Yeovil] first and that I can play in League One and score goals. "I will just take each game as it comes and, hopefully, show people what I can do, play well for the team and add some goals."
